In today’s digital-first world, Software as a Service (SaaS) has transformed how businesses operate. From CRMs to project management tools, SaaS applications are at the core of modern-day operations. But with this reliance comes responsibility. Ensuring your SaaS application is always performing optimally, remains secure, and scales with user demand is non-negotiable. That’s where SaaS application monitoring comes into play.
This comprehensive guide explores what SaaS application monitoring entails, the tools that can help, key benefits, and the best practices you should adopt to ensure performance, security, and a seamless user experience.
What is SaaS Application Monitoring?
SaaS application monitoring is the continuous process of tracking the performance, availability, security, and health of a SaaS-based application. It involves collecting data from various parts of the application, analyzing that data in real-time, and responding proactively to any issues or anomalies.
Monitoring is no longer a luxury; it is a core requirement for ensuring customer satisfaction, minimizing downtime, and driving product improvements.
Core Aspects of SaaS Application Monitoring:
- Performance Monitoring
Monitor CPU usage, memory consumption, response times, and overall load time to detect slowdowns or resource overuse. - Availability Monitoring
Ensure your application is always accessible and functioning by checking uptime and service responsiveness across all user touchpoints. - Security Monitoring
Stay ahead of threats by detecting vulnerabilities, intrusion attempts, unauthorized access, and misconfigurations before they escalate. - User Experience Monitoring
Analyze how users interact with your application. Identify bottlenecks or frustrating flows that may cause drop-offs or reduce satisfaction. - Infrastructure Monitoring
Keep track of backend components such as servers, databases, APIs, and third-party services to prevent disruptions and ensure smooth operations.
Why SaaS Application Monitoring Matters
Monitoring your application is no longer optional—it’s essential. Here’s why:
- Improve User Experience & Retention
If your app is slow, crashes, or behaves unexpectedly, users will leave. Monitoring helps catch and resolve performance issues before they impact users. - Reduce Downtime
Every minute your app is down can cost revenue and trust. Monitoring tools provide real-time alerts, allowing your team to act quickly and minimize disruptions. - Ensure Security & Compliance
Regulations like GDPR, HIPAA, and SOC 2 require strict data handling and continuous monitoring. Staying compliant means being proactive about detecting and addressing security threats. - Make Smarter Product Decisions
Real-time monitoring gives teams clear visibility into how the app is performing. This data helps prioritize bug fixes, feature improvements, and resource allocation. - Gain a Competitive Edge
In a crowded SaaS market, performance and reliability are key differentiators. A stable, fast app not only retains users—it attracts new ones through positive word-of-mouth.
With the right monitoring tools in place, you don’t just avoid problems—you create a better, more reliable product that supports long-term growth.
Types of SaaS Monitoring Tools
SaaS applications require consistent and intelligent monitoring to ensure performance, reliability, and security. Here’s a breakdown of the major categories of SaaS monitoring tools and what they do:
1. Application Performance Monitoring (APM)
APM tools offer deep visibility into the backend of your application, helping teams pinpoint performance issues.
Top Tools:
- New Relic
- AppDynamics
- Dynatrace
Key Features:
- Tracks application response times and throughput
- Detects slow transactions and backend errors
- Provides code-level diagnostics for developers
2. Log Management and Analysis
Logs are a rich source of insights for debugging and troubleshooting. These tools help collect, search, and analyze log data efficiently.
Top Tools:
- ELK Stack (Elasticsearch, Logstash, Kibana)
- Splunk
- Datadog
Key Features:
- Aggregates logs from multiple systems and services
- Identifies anomalies, warnings, and failures
- Enables real-time visualization and reporting
3. Infrastructure Monitoring
These tools ensure your servers, cloud environments, and containers are operating optimally.
Top Tools:
- Prometheus + Grafana
- Nagios
- Zabbix
Key Features:
- Monitors CPU, RAM, and disk usage
- Triggers alerts based on usage thresholds
- Visualizes performance metrics with custom dashboards
4. Real User Monitoring (RUM)
RUM tools observe real users’ interactions to help improve frontend performance and user experience.
Top Tools:
- Pingdom
- Google Lighthouse
- SpeedCurve
Key Features:
- Tracks page load speed and performance by location/device
- Monitors frontend bottlenecks affecting UX
- Provides detailed insights into actual user behavior
5. Synthetic Monitoring
Instead of waiting for real users to encounter issues, synthetic monitoring simulates user activity to proactively detect problems.
Top Tools:
- Uptrends
- Site24x7
- Sematext
Key Features:
- Simulates critical user journeys (e.g., login, checkout)
- Monitors uptime and server response times
- Sends alerts for performance dips or failures
6. Security Monitoring
Protecting data and infrastructure is crucial for any SaaS business. These tools detect threats and prevent exploits.
Top Tools:
- Snyk
- Cloudflare
- Datadog Security Monitoring
Key Features:
- Scans for code vulnerabilities and insecure dependencies
- Blocks DDoS and suspicious activity
- Offers compliance and threat intelligence reporting
Each tool type plays a vital role in maintaining a high-performing, secure, and reliable SaaS environment.
Benefits of SaaS Application Monitoring
SaaS application monitoring offers powerful benefits that go beyond just system health—it strengthens your product, improves collaboration, and drives user satisfaction. Here’s how:
- Proactive Issue Resolution
Monitoring tools detect performance issues and errors before users notice, allowing your team to address them early and reduce customer complaints. - Enhanced User Experience
By tracking UX metrics like load times and uptime, teams can ensure the platform stays responsive and reliable—two key factors in user satisfaction. - Faster Debugging & Root Cause Analysis
With detailed logs, traces, and error tracking, developers can quickly identify and fix bugs, improving resolution times. - Improved Cross-Team Collaboration
Monitoring platforms give DevOps, Security, and Engineering teams access to shared performance data—aligning everyone around the same insights and speeding up decision-making. - Compliance & Reporting
Meet regulatory standards with auditable logs, real-time alerts, and detailed reports for internal or external compliance checks. - Resource & Cost Optimization
Gain visibility into infrastructure usage to identify idle resources, reduce waste, and fine-tune performance. - Reduced Churn & Downtime
A more stable app experience reduces user frustration, helping lower churn rates and avoiding costly outages.
SaaS monitoring ensures smooth operations while enabling your team to move faster, smarter, and more efficiently.
Best Practices for SaaS Application Monitoring
Monitoring your SaaS application effectively is not just about avoiding downtime—it’s about delivering a smooth, fast, and secure experience to your users. Here are the top best practices you should follow to build a strong monitoring foundation:
✅ 1. Set Clear Monitoring Goals
Before diving into tools, define your goals. What do you want to monitor?
- App performance (latency, uptime)
- Availability (downtime alerts)
- User satisfaction (page load time, error rates)
This helps you focus your efforts on what really matters.
✅ 2. Use a Combination of Tools
No single tool can monitor everything. Use a layered approach:
- APM (Application Performance Monitoring): For backend and performance.
- RUM (Real User Monitoring): For frontend and real-world user experience.
- Security monitoring tools: For threat detection and vulnerability alerts.
This ensures end-to-end visibility across the stack.
✅ 3. Set Up Real-Time Alerts
Speed matters when things go wrong.
- Create threshold-based alerts (e.g., CPU usage > 90%)
- Use anomaly detection to catch unusual spikes or dips
- Make sure alerts go to the right team in real time
✅ 4. Centralize Monitoring Dashboards
Avoid context switching.
- Use one unified dashboard to see logs, metrics, and user activity
- Choose platforms that integrate with your stack (e.g., Datadog, New Relic)
A “single pane of glass” improves troubleshooting speed.
✅ 5. Monitor Critical User Journeys
Focus on what your users care about most:
- Signups
- Onboarding flows
- Checkout process
If these flows are slow or broken, users will churn fast.
✅ 6. Log Everything (Within Reason)
Good logs are the backbone of debugging.
- Log server errors, API calls, and user actions
- Make sure logs are structured and easy to search
- Store what you can afford—balance cost and value
✅ 7. Test in Staging Before Going Live
Don’t let production be your first test environment.
- Use synthetic monitoring and load testing tools
- Identify performance bottlenecks early
✅ 8. Conduct Regular Monitoring Audits
Your monitoring needs evolve.
- Review tools and alerts monthly or quarterly
- Retire outdated metrics and set up new ones
✅ 9. Watch Third-Party Dependencies
External tools can impact your app.
- Monitor APIs, CDNs, plugins, and integrations
- Set up alerts if any of them fail or slow down
✅ 10. Track SLAs and SLOs
Meeting client expectations is key.
- Set internal goals (SLOs) aligned with client commitments (SLAs)
- Monitor uptime, response time, and error rates to stay on target
Following these best practices ensures your SaaS application remains reliable, fast, and customer-friendly.
Challenges in SaaS Application Monitoring
Monitoring a SaaS application is essential, but it comes with its own set of challenges. Here are some common ones and how to manage them:
- Data Overload
Too many logs and alerts can flood your team.
✅ Solution: Use smart filtering and prioritize critical alerts. - Tool Integration Complexity
Juggling different monitoring tools can become messy.
✅ Solution: Choose solutions that offer seamless integrations with your existing tech stack. - Cost Management
Monitoring costs can spike as your app grows.
✅ Solution: Pick tools that scale with your business and fit within your budget. - False Positives
Excessive alerts can cause alert fatigue and lead to missed real issues.
✅ Solution: Regularly fine-tune thresholds and alert settings. - Security Blind Spots
Poor configurations can leave your system exposed to threats.
✅ Solution: Ensure complete coverage and conduct regular security audits.
Addressing these challenges early helps build a resilient monitoring strategy.
Future of SaaS Application Monitoring
The future of SaaS application monitoring is being reshaped by AI, automation, and evolving infrastructure. Here’s what’s on the horizon:
- AI-Driven Monitoring
AI will rapidly detect anomalies, reduce noise, and even predict potential outages before they impact users. - Self-Healing Systems
Automated systems will resolve common issues on their own, minimizing downtime and reducing the need for manual intervention. - Edge Monitoring
With apps running closer to users through CDNs and edge networks, real-time edge monitoring will become vital for performance tracking. - Unified Observability
Teams will rely more on platforms that integrate metrics, logs, and traces into a single dashboard—providing complete visibility and faster root cause analysis.
These innovations will make SaaS monitoring more proactive, intelligent, and resilient, helping businesses ensure uninterrupted user experiences.
Conclusion
SaaS application monitoring is a must-have for any modern digital product. Whether you’re a startup or an enterprise SaaS provider, proactive monitoring ensures uptime, improves UX, enhances security, and helps you stay ahead of your competition.
By combining the right tools, aligning your monitoring with business goals, and continuously iterating your monitoring practices, you set your SaaS application up for long-term success.
Invest in monitoring today—your users, your developers, and your bottom line will thank you tomorrow.
Connect Monitoring with Smarter SaaS Marketing
SaaS application monitoring helps keep your product stable, responsive, and secure—but stability alone doesn’t drive growth. To attract users, earn trust, and stand out in a competitive market, you need a marketing strategy that matches your product’s performance. From SEO and content strategies to targeted outreach and link building, a well-rounded SaaS marketing approach ensures your application reaches the right audience.
👉 Explore proven strategies to grow your SaaS business in our Complete SaaS Marketing Guide.